Clement Freud paedophile revelation horrifies family of missing Madeleine McCann

THE family of missing British girl Madeleine McCann have been left horrified by revelations that a former MP who befriended them had sexually abused girls.

Maddie McCann disappeared in 2007 and police have issued several composites of what she may look like today.

A BRITISH politician who this week has been exposed a child sex abuser has been linked to the family of missing Madeleine McCann.

Clement Freud, who died in 2009, was the grandson of psychoanalytic pioneer Sigmund Freud and had befriended the McCanns following the disappearance of their daughter.

However this week it emerged Freud has sexually abused young girls in news which has horrified the McCanns, UK newspaper The Telegraph reported.

Madeleine disappeared while on holiday with her mother Kate, father Gerry and twin siblings Sean and Amelie in Praia da Luz, Portugal in 2007.

Sir Clement Freud died in 2009.

Freud had a villa nearby and reached out to the couple following their daughter’s disappearance.

According to The Telegraph, the McCanns visited Freud at his home on at least two occasions and kept in touch with the family up until his death.

Police investigating Maddie’s disappearance are aware of the new information and are set to decide whether it will form part of their new investigation.

Freud, who was a member of Parliament from 1973 to 1987 and also a well-known journalist, was exposed as a child abuser after a victim contacted ITV’s Exposure documentary team, the same group which broke the story of Jimmy Savile’s history of paedophilia.

As another victim came forward to reveal more about Freud’s past, his widow has apologised over the events.

Jill Freud said in a statement she was “profoundly sorry” about the events.

“This is a very sad day for me,” she said.

“I was married to Clement for 58 years and loved him dearly. I am shocked, deeply saddened and profoundly sorry for what has happened to these women. I sincerely hope they will now have some peace.”

The widow’s statement was made public last night ahead of an ITV Exposure documentary accusing Freud of abusing two girls between the late 1940s and 1970s.

One of the accusers, Sylvia Woosley, told the program he molested her for several years.

Woosley, now in her late 70s, said she came forward because she wants “to clear things up before I die ... I want to die clean.”

She lived with the Freuds for five years, starting when she was 14.

The second accuser has remained anonymous and claims Freud abused her when she was a child and raped her when she was 18.
